Petrogenesis And Ore-bearing Analysis Of Granite In Southern Tieli City,Heilongjiang Province

The southern area of Tieli City lies at the junction of Songnen Terrane and Yichun-Yanshou magma arc.This area is located in the Lesser Xing'an Range-Zhangguangcai Range metallogenic belt,which is an momentous polymetallic metallogenic belt in China.The region has undergone a long geological evolution.The Mesozoic magmatic activitiy continually and form a mass of acid intrusive rocks.In this paper,the petrological characteristics,geochemical characteristics and zircon chronological characteristics have been studied to discuss the genesis,source of diagenetic material,tectonic settings of granite in the southern area of Tieli City.Combined with regional tectonic background and mineral resources,the ore-bearing properties of granite is analyzed.The zircon U-Pb isotope test dating results of granite porphyry and syenogranite samples in the southern area of Tieli city were 114.06±0.95Ma and 101.66±0.93Ma,respectively,which were the products of magmatic activities in the late Yanshanian.Both granite porphyry and syenogranite belong to the high potassium,calcium alkaline and peraluminous magmatic rock.The trace elements showed the enrichment of Rb,Th,Sm,Nd,the depletion of Sr,Ba,Ti,P.Total rare earth elements?REE in granite porphyry is 116.07-237.83×10-6,LREE/HREE=6.79-14.02,?La/Yb?N is5.6520.02.?Eu is 0.02-1.26,which shows the trend from slight positive anomaly to negative anomaly.Total rare earth elements?REE of syenogranite is225.76-237.91×10-6,LREE/HREE=3.86-6.45,which belong to the light rare earth enrichment type.?La/Yb?N is 3.40-5.78,?Eu is 0.04-0.06,the Eu negative anomaly is obvious.Combining the characteristics of Nb/Ta and Zr/Hf ratios,the material sources of the granite porphyry samples in research area are mainly crustal materials,and some of them may come from the mixture of crustal and mantle materials.Syenogranite may formed by asthenosphere material upwelling in large quantities and crust material mixed with remelting.The characteristics of trace and rare earth elements shows that the granite porphyry and syenogranite experienced the fractional crystallization of minerals such as plagioclase,amphibole and biotite.Granite porphyry was formed in the back-arc rift settings and syenogranite was formed in the post collision extensional environment.It is the product of delamination and the thinning of lithospheric after the subduction of the Paleo-Pacific plate to the Eurasian continental plate.The early Cretaceous granite in the south area of Tieli City has a similar diagenetic environment to the ore-forming rocks of the contemporary molybdenum and gold deposits.The geochemical characteristics shows that the rock mass has good ore-bearing property and certain metallogenic potential of molybdenum and gold.
